Russian shelling kills 11 in Donetsk region while Ukraine claims it hit a Crimean air base

  • A Russian missile strike in the Ukrainian town of Pokrovsk killed 11 people, including five children.
  • The Ukrainian military claims to have successfully attacked the Saki military airbase in Russian-occupied Crimea.
  • Russian officials did not comment on the alleged attack, but Russia's Defense Ministry announced shooting down four Ukrainian missiles and six anti-ship missiles.
